## Formula sandbox tuning

User-supplied formulas in Gridmoor execute inside a restricted interpreter with hard ceilings on time, memory, and call depth. Reviewers should confirm any change to these ceilings is justified in the PR description, since raising them widens the abuse surface. Defaults were chosen from production traces. The current limits are as follows.

limits module of tafog-fawip:
WEIGHTS = {
    "julix": 57,
    "lamys": 992,
    "kasvan": 209,
    "quenok": 750,
    "alddor": 259,
    "oliath": 1009,
    "wenix": 815,
}

Welcome to the Mailwick plugin program. Plugins that register batch email digests must declare a schedule in their manifest; the Mailwick scheduler coalesces digests into hourly, daily, or weekly windows based on subscriber preferences. Your plugin should never send directly — enqueue digest items via the provided hook and let the scheduler handle delivery windows and retries. During development, point your plugin at the sandbox digest queue, which tracks schedule state in a shared Postgres instance. Connect to it with the following string.

primary connection of yagep-kahip = redis://giliel_svc:zYiKsLL2PLpfPL@db-348f.xolmarsys.corp:5432/fenwyn

### Nightly Reindex — Quickstart

Every night around 02:00 the Lanternfish indexer rebuilds the search corpus for Shelfwise. You usually won't need to touch it, but if a reindex fails you can kick one off manually by POSTing to the indexer's `/reindex` endpoint. It's idempotent, so don't panic about double-triggering. Requests must be authenticated against the internal Lanternfish control service using the key below.

gateway credential: qvz7-vWy80ME

== Document Transport: Courier Change After Missed Pick-up ==

When a scheduled courier misses a pick-up, dispatch switches the consignment to the standby provider, Marlowe Express, without repacking. Update the manifest, note the original seal numbers, and inform the receiving office at Tillbrook House of the new arrival window. The confidential hand-over instruction for the replacement courier is recorded directly below.

courier memo of tawep-tajep: the quenius ulaiel courier leaves the fenir ledger at gate 9128 under passcode 527513